CBC With Diff
Test CodeCBC
Alias/See Also
CBC
CPT Codes
85025
Includes
WBC, RBC, HGB, HCT, MCV, MCH, MCHC, PLT, NEUT%,LYMPH%, MONO%, EO% BASO%, RDW, IG%, NRBC%
Preferred Specimen
1 - K2EDTA Lavendar Top Tube
Minimum Volume
1 mL
Other Acceptable Specimens
NONE
Transport Container
LAV/1
Specimen Stability
24 hours
Reject Criteria (Eg, hemolysis? Lipemia? Thaw/Other?)
Clotted Sample; Sample >24 hours old
Methodology
Electronic Resistance Detection with Enhanced Hydrodynamic Focusing
Setup Schedule
Daily on Receipt
Reference Range
SEE REPORT
Clinical Significance
The CBC is instrumental in the diagnosis & maintenance of leukemias, anemias, and many other pathological disorders which manifest themselves in the peripheral blood. The CBC is a hematological profile consisting of a hemagram and differential.
